Additional measures have been taken in the Republic of Belarus in order to prevent the importation and spread of infection caused by the Сoronavirus COVID-19

14.10.2020

On 14 October 2020 the National Legal Internet Portal published the Resolution of the Council of Ministers of the Republic of Belarus from 13 October 2020 No. 591 «On amendments to the Resolutions of the Council of Ministers of the Republic of Belarus No. 171 dated March 25, 2020 and No. 208 dated April 8, 2020», which comes into force from 15 October 2020.

The document establishes that persons who arrived in the Republic of Belarus from countries in which cases of COVID-19 are registered, as well as those who were in transit through these countries, in the absence of documentary confirmation of their stay in the transit countries for no more than 24 hours, must be in self-isolation within 10 calendar days from the date of arrival in the Republic of Belarus (previously this period was 14 calendar days) and are not subject to subsequent passage through the State border of the Republic of Belarus (until the expiration of the period of self-isolation).

The List of countries in which cases of COVID-19 are registered is posted on the official website of the Ministry of Health of the Republic of Belarus.

New - starting from 15 October 2020 foreign citizens and stateless persons, with the exception of permanent residents of the Republic of Belarus, who arrived from countries not included in the list, when crossing the State Border of the Republic of Belarus must have an original medical document (in Russian, Belarusian or English languages), confirming a negative laboratory test result for COVID-19 infection, performed by PCR no later than 72 hours before the date of crossing the State Border of the Republic of Belarus).

Border service officers and customs officials (at the border crossing points at which border control is carried out by customs authorities) control the availability of the specified medical document and also issue to persons, arriving from countries included in the List of countries in which cases of COVID-19 are registered, the arrival questionnaire and, if necessary, the requirement to comply with the rules of conduct in self-isolation.

The requirements for self-isolation and the need to have a medical document do not apply to drivers of vehicles intended for international road transport, as well as the transport of international mail.
